  • A SET OF THREE QUEEN ANNE SILVER CASTERS, CHARLES ADAM, LONDON 1706
  • 15.5cm high, Combined weight 575gms respectively, combined weight 575gms
each of baluster form, the covers with bayonet lock, finely pierced covers and orb finial, the sideengraved with initials within a scroll cartouche, raised on circular spreading foot

Provenance

Sold by Sotheby's Melbourne 23 April 1991, Lot 472c

Condition

some of the marks are rubbed, one of the smaller casters has a hole below the bayonet lock, one has a very small repaired hole to lower body, small dents and abrasions consistent with age
